CRICKET.
■ ■ ♦ ; AUSTRALIANS v. HAMPSHIRE, Press Assn— By telegraph— Copyright. LONDON, yesterday. The Australians won with six winkets to spare. Bowling analysis : Newman, 1 for 57 ; Brown, 1 for 14 ; Llewellyn, 2 for 43; Mead, 0 for 19; Hill, 0 for 4; Remnant, 0 for 9. The pitch was faster in the Australians' second innings. The Bards-ley-Armstrong partnership, lasting 65 minutes, carried -the total to 101 before the third wicket fell. The fourth wicket went at 139. Armstrong batted 95. minutes, and gave a splendid display. He made a sixer and nine fours. ' Gregory and MacAlister added the balance of the runs required. The weather was brighter and the attendance increased to 5000.
